检查用户的 Postgres 访问权限

2024-03-25

我已经查看了文档GRANT Found here http://www.postgresql.org/docs/9.0/static/sql-grant.html我试图看看是否有一个内置函数可以让我查看数据库的可访问性级别。当然有:

\dp and \dp mytablename

但这并没有显示我的帐户有权访问什么。我想查看我有权访问的所有表格。谁能告诉我是否有一个命令可以检查我在 Postgres 中的访问级别(我是否有SELECT, INSERT, DELETE, UPDATE特权)?如果是这样,该命令是什么?


您可以查询table_privileges信息模式中的表:

SELECT table_catalog, table_schema, table_name, privilege_type
FROM   information_schema.table_privileges 
WHERE  grantee = 'MY_USER'
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

检查用户的 Postgres 访问权限 的相关文章

随机推荐

  • 如何使用 sqlalchemy IntegrityError 查找有问题的属性

    我有一个非常简单的 SqlAlchemy 模型 class User Base The SQLAlchemy declarative model class for a User object tablename users id Colu
  • Javascript - 跟踪任何 xmlhttprequest

    我可以检查页面上的任何 XmlHttpRequest 可执行文件 而无需分别添加 addEventListener 吗 我尝试添加 document addEventListener loadend 但什么也没发生 看起来请求没有全局事件
  • 在Python中提取每个子列表的第一项

    我想知道提取列表列表中每个子列表的第一项并将其附加到新列表的最佳方法是什么 所以如果我有 lst a b c 1 2 3 x y z 还有 我想拔出来a 1 and x并从中创建一个单独的列表 I tried lst2 append x 0
  • 在python中读取二进制文件

    我必须用 python 读取二进制文件 首先由 Fortran 90 程序这样编写 open unit 10 file filename form unformatted write 10 table n1 table n2 write 1
  • 如何将wordpress循环与网格系统引导程序一起使用?

    我想显示一个带两列的条形行 其中包含wordpress循环内容 标题 以绿色块表示 每行都有白色和灰色背景的列 这些列在每行中反转 就像国际象棋检查器一样 see the image for more detail 编辑答案 我相信这就是您
  • 如何让 Windows 错误报告 (WER) 保存内存转储以防止挂起?

    WER 正在应用程序挂起后创建内存转储 当 Windows 显示对话框时应用名称没有回应 如果用户点击关闭程序 我可以看到正在创建的 hdmp 文件C ProgramData Microsoft Windows WER Temp 将它们发送
  • 如何在 CherryPy 中使用 cookie 和 HTTP 基本身份验证?

    我有一个需要身份验证的 CherryPy Web 应用程序 我正在使用 HTTP 基本身份验证 其配置如下所示 app config tools sessions on True tools sessions name zknsrv too
  • 获取字符串形式的命令行参数

    我想将所有命令行参数打印为单个字符串 我如何调用脚本以及我期望打印的内容的示例 RunT py mytst tst c qwerty c mytst tst c qwerty c 执行此操作的代码 args str sys argv 1 a
  • PostgreSQL upsert 查询的问题

    我正在尝试通过更新或插入新记录来更新数据库投票用户表 该表定义如下 Column Type Modifiers id integer not null default nextval vote user table id seq regcl
  • 如何对类或函数定义进行哈希处理?

    背景 在尝试机器学习时 我经常通过 pickling unpickling 的方式重用之前训练过的模型 然而 在进行特征提取部分时 不混淆不同的模型是一个挑战 因此 我想添加一项检查 以确保使用与测试数据完全相同的特征提取过程来训练模型 P
  • 使用 nginx proxy_pass 和重写的多个 django 应用程序

    我有一个名为的 django admin 应用程序myapp我想在不同的物理盒子上部署多个实例 每个客户一个 但是 我希望它们都可以从类似的域访问 mydomain com customer1 myapp 我摆弄了特定的代理设置 并尝试了多
  • 如何在 JSF2 中将一个 @Named bean 注入到另一个 @Named bean 中?

    我有以下代码 Named RequestScoped public class SearchBean private String title private String author getters and setter s In se
  • C++ 中的结构对齐

    struct Vector float x y z func Vector vectors usage load float coords load file func coords 我有一个关于 C 中结构对齐的问题 我将把一组点传递给函
  • 如何检测scala执行上下文耗尽?

    我的 Playframework 应用程序有时没有响应 我想在运行时检测到这一点 记录有关当前在耗尽的执行上下文上运行的内容的信息 实现这一目标的最佳策略是什么 我考虑过将小型可运行对象发布到执行上下文 如果它们没有及时执行 我会记录一条警
  • 在 TabLayout 支持库中以编程方式设置选项卡指示器位置

    在我的应用程序中 我使用支持库中的 TabLayout 和视图寻呼机 其中有 3 个片段 假设我在 fragA 中 其中有一个按钮 单击该按钮会将我带到 fragB 我成功地转到 fragB 但唯一的问题是选项卡指示器保留在fragA Co
  • Meteor:读取简单的 JSON 文件

    我正在尝试使用 Meteor 读取 JSON 文件 我在 stackoverflow 上看到了各种答案 但似乎无法让它们发挥作用 我有试过这个 https stackoverflow com questions 22004412 how t
  • 如何使用 WPF 获得本机“外观和感觉”?

    我刚刚开始开发 WPF 应用程序 这不是我的第一个 WPF 应用程序 但它将是第一个需要改进的应用程序 我对 WPF 的 管道 了解很多 例如绑定等 但对如何完善它知之甚少 我不需要时髦的用户界面 我只需要一些看起来像本机 Windows
  • 从 Trello 身份验证中获取“未找到应用程序”

    我正在尝试调用 Trello API 的身份验证部分以获得用户令牌 我正在使用这个网址 https trello com 1 authorize callback method postMessage return url http 3A
  • python 模拟和未安装的库

    我正在为机器人开发软件 该软件通常在 Raspberry Pi 上运行 让我们考虑两个文件的导入 motor py 运行电机 from RPi import GPIO as gpio and client py 与服务器通信并将命令转发给电
  • 检查用户的 Postgres 访问权限

    我已经查看了文档GRANT Found here http www postgresql org docs 9 0 static sql grant html我试图看看是否有一个内置函数可以让我查看数据库的可访问性级别 当然有 dp and